This is a part time occasional/PRN Phlebotomist position. The home base is St. Mary's Hospital in Janesville will float to Dean locations in Edgerton, Evansville, Fort Atkinson and Whitewater. The primary shift available for pick up is 8:00 a.m. to 5:00 p.m. Monday through Friday.
Job Summary:
Under direct supervision, this position performs routine laboratory tasks according to procedures. May perform phlebotomy and/or waived testing. May also perform a variety of general clerical duties to support the laboratory department, including receptionist and secretarial support, admission activities, and order entry processing.Job Responsibilities and Requirements:
